FirePro M4170 has an age advantage of 3 years, and a 42.9% more advanced lithography process.

Plex 7000, on the other hand, has a 500% higher maximum VRAM amount.

We couldn't decide between FirePro M4170 and Quadro Plex 7000. We've got no test results to judge.

Be aware that FirePro M4170 is a mobile workstation graphics card while Quadro Plex 7000 is a workstation one.
